A polo shirt (50/50 blend preferred) is defined as a shirt with two or three buttons with a collar.
The placket should be no longer than 5". Deep-cut polos
are not acceptable.
-
All shirts must be tucked in.
-
Undershirts will be allowed only if they are
plain white, black, or gray.
-
Only the school logo may be printed on shirts.
-
No hoodies will be allowed.
-
Pants, shorts, skirts and jackets must be
properly fitted (not oversized). Waistbands are to be
fitted to the waist as pants, shorts, etc. will not be allowed to sag.
-
Pleated pants are preferred.
-
Not Acceptable: Cargo (outside pockets),
corduroy or denim material, fringed hems, sweat pants,
wind-suits, stretch pants, Abercrombie and Fitch, American
Eagle, or flip-flops.
-
Skirts, shorts, & skorts will be finger-tip
length or longer.
-
No bare midriffs or high-waisted shirts
may be worn.
-
Plaid must be in school colors (available at
K-Renee and C & J).
-
Excessive jewelry/accessories are not
acceptable. Good taste is expected.
-
Leggings, tights, and fish-net hose are not
acceptable.
-
Skirts should not be worn over sweat pants or
slacks.
-
Blouses and shirts should be buttoned and fit
comfortably. Appropriate size is important.
-
Socks may be white, black, purple, or gray, in
solids or simple stripes or dots.
-
Beaded jewelry must be in school colors.
-
Sweatshirts must be crewneck (no hoodies), and
must be in black, white, purple, or gray, and may only be worn
over a uniform polo.
